Well these are the three most important terms you have to know and understand what the differences are when having to hire packers & movers or a moving company to move your personal belongings from city to city. Most companies are not the same in terms of what to expect from movers. Most companies have hired moving professionals.

First, is a Non-Binding Estimate. This is the best way of making sure that you’re financially protected by a moving company is to get all expected services in writing. That is something that you can’t ignore or skimp on. Getting all the movers do’s and don’ts in writing is the only way you can know for sure what you can expect. Many people fall into the idea that movers are expected to move anything and move it anywhere. That is a mistake that will cost you big time. It is to your advantage not to choose non-binding estimates because that is when rates can go up and you are responsible for the differences.

Second, is a Binding Estimate. Once you’ve done your homework of getting several quotes to find who has the better rates and services and as long as you have it in writing from your choice moving company, you generally have about 60 days for your estimate to keep at the price and terms stated. Especially if you have a family to consider not having to scout around again for an affordable rate is better for you and your family in the long run. This is the better of the terms because you know up front what you are expected to pay and what you can expect from the movers I terms of how much and where to move your items.

Third, is a Not-to-Exceed Binding Estimate and when it comes to moving terminology; this is the most important thing you need to be familiar with in order to keep from getting ripped off from moving companies. This is the difference to paying only what was stated on your moving contract to then shelling out big bucks because you didn’t do a thorough job of understand that moving companies can issue three different types of estimates.

The kind of estimate that gives you the best of both worlds is the third type of estimate. The movers give you a Binding Estimate, then weigh the vehicle and reduce the price if the weight is less than anticipated.

This is where you can save a lot of money.
Keep that in mind because if you think that you got a great rate you probably did because the company cut corners and hired day laborers to pack your stuff. These types of movers typically are not as packing educated or careful as skilled and professional packers and movers.

Packers and Movers rates can vary from state to state so you can’t expect what you think is fair in one city will be the same for another.
